Wellman foregoes final two years, signs with NHL’s Wild

Within a week of UMass’ season ending, Casey Wellman was back on the ice with a new jersey. The sophomore signed a free-agent contract with the Minnesota Wild, recording an assist in his first two games as a professional.

UMass’ season ends in first round of Hockey East tournament

Despite winning the last two games of the regular season to make the Hockey East tournament, the Minutemen fell in the first two games of its best-of-three series with Boston College in the opening round. The two losses gave UMass a 0-5 record on the season against the Eagles.

Rally carries Minutemen over Great Danes

After falling behind 4-1 early to Albany, the Massachusetts men’s lacrosse team used a 10-2 run to end the game, and came away with an 11-6 win Tuesday afternoon at Garber Field.

Marnie Dacko out as women’s basketball coach

After eight seasons at the helm of the Minutewomen, coach Marnie Dacko will not return to the team next season. UMass Athletic Director John McCutcheon announced Monday afternoon that her contract would not be extended after its expiration on April 10.

Last-second shot launches UMass into A-10 Tournament

With their fate in their own hands, the Massachusetts men’s basketball team came through with a big win over Rhode Island on senior night to earn a spot in the Atlantic 10 Tournament. Tied at 67, senior Ricky Harris drove into the paint before hitting a shot with three seconds remaining to give the Minutemen the victory.

Minutemen drop out of playoff picture with loss to No. 7 Eagles

While UMass put together a better performance than it had over the past couple of weeks, it still wasn’t enough as it fell to Boston College, 2-1, in overtime. The loss, coupled with two wins by Vermont, currently has the Minutemen in ninth place and out of the Hockey East playoff picture.
